In the work, we study the production of dark baryon ψ with the bottom-baryon decays Λb→Mψ under the perturbative QCD approach. For the Type-I/II models in B-Mesogenesis scenarios, we calculate the form factors for bottom-baryon decays into meson. Using these results, we obtain branching ratios for Λb→Mψ decays. The PQCD approach calculations show these branching ratios reach O(10−5) in both models, with B(Λb→Kψ) specifically reaching O(10−4) in Type-II. These accessible magnitudes make the predictions testable at the LHCb and B-factories with improved precision.
